The present study examined the follicular populations prior to and during superovulation and investigated their relationship with superovulatory response in crossbred cattle. Eleven animals were administered i.m. 8 doses of Folltropin of 2.5 ml each (1.75 mg/ml) spread over 4 days beginning on Day 10 of oestrous cycle, and 30 and 20 mg Lutalyse was given along with the 5th and 6th injections of Folltropin respectively, to induce luteolysis. The animals were artificially inseminated 48, 60 and 72 h after the first Lutalyse injection. The number of corpora lutea (CL) was recorded by palpation per rectum and embryos were recovered non-surgically on Day 6 (Day 0 = day of superoestrus). The ovarian follicular population was examined by transrectal ultrasonography 15 h prior to and 52 h after the first FSH injection, and then on the day of superoestrus and the day of flushing. Superovulation is the production of many mature eggs in one menstrual cycle, usually triggered by a medicine that stimulates the ovaries. Such medicines include clomiphene, follicle-stimulating hormone (FSH), and gonadotropins. Superovulation with gonadotropins or FSH is watched closely to prevent severe ovarian...

The effect of different eCG concentrations on the efficiency of superovulation in Formosan sambar dose. Hsin-Hung Lin, Chih-Hua Wang, Shann-Ren Kang, Wen-Lin Song, Chin-Hui Tseng, Mu-Jung Cheng, Shyh-Shyan Liu, and Perng-Chih Shen. The aim of this study was to examine the effect of different eCG concentrations on the efficacy of superovulation in Formosan Sambar does. All the does were implanted with CIDR for 12 days and superovulation was induced by intramuscularly injection with different concentrations of eCG at day 10. Embryos were collected by flushing the oviduct through midventral laparotomy at day 4 after mating. Results showed that the corpus luteum (CL) numbers of dose superovulated with 1500 (7.3), 2000 (10.6), 3000 (8.5) IU of eCG were significantly higher than that superovulated with 1000 IU of eCG (3.5). However, the embryo recovery rates of dose superovulated with 1000 (85.7%) and 1500 (62.0%) IU of eCG were significantly higher than those superovulated with 2000 (25.5%) and 3000 ...

Embryos from ageing (20 to 148 weeks of age) and young (20 to 30 weeks of age) donors were transferred to ageing (52 to 221 weeks of age) and young (18 to 30 weeks of age) recipients to partition the effects of ageing oocytes and uterine environment on embryo mortality. More than 3300 two- to eight-cell embryos collected following superovulation at six 6-month intervals were transferred. The average number of ovulation points per ageing donor doe superovulated at the six intervals declined with age and repeated superovulation. The average number of ovulations for the young donors at the six intervals also differed slightly, the low number (forty-one) for the last group possibly being due to the crossbred strain used. Both embryo recovery and cleavage rates usually exceeded 80% and did not differ between young and ageing donors. Superovulation of Bos taurus beef cattle with two injections of Folltropin. John F. Hasler. Bioniche Animal Health, Inc.. [email protected]. Due to the rapid absorption and short half-life of FSH, superovulation of cattle has traditionally been done with 7 or 8 bi-daily injections of FSH over a four day period. Restraining beef cattle for multiple injections involves time and expense. In addition, depending on breed and handling facilities, there are various degrees of stress to the cattle and increased risk of injury to both cattle and humans.. Trials conducted during the recent past involving Angus and Simmental cattle in Argentina demonstrated that when Folltropin was diluted in the glycosaminoglycan hyaluronan, two injections of Folltropin 48 h apart resulted in superovulation and embryo production comparable to the traditional 8 injection protocol (Tribulo, et al., 2011, 2012). The diluent containing hyaluronan is now characterized as a slow release diluent (SRF). These studies were ...

Thirty-six domestic cats received 100 iu hCG (i.m.) on day 1, 2 or 3 of a natural, behavioural oestrus. Twenty-two anoestrous cats were injected with 150 iu pregnant mares serum gonadotrophin (PMSG; i.m.) followed 84 h later by 100 iu hCG. Twenty-four to 26 h after hCG, all cats were examined laparoscopically to determine the number of ovarian follicles and to recover follicular eggs. Mature eggs were cultured with conspecific spermatozoa and examined 30 h later for cleavage. Within the natural oestrus group, cats on day 1 produced fewer (P | 0.05) follicles and total eggs than females on day 2 or 3, and 88.9% of the day 1 eggs were degenerate or immature and unsuitable for in vitro fertilization (IVF). Although only 54.5% of the cats in the PMSG/hCG group exhibited overt oestrus, mean (± SEM) numbers of follicles (9.7 ± 0.8) and oocytes recovered (8.7 ± 0.8) were at least twofold greater (P | 0.001) than those measured in the natural oestrus group (3.7 ± 0.6; 3.4 ± 0.6, respectively) or subgroups

Reproductive biotechnologies continue to be developed for genetic improvement of both river and swamp buffalo. Although artificial insemination using frozen semen emerged some decades back, there are still considerable limitations. The major problem appears to be the lack of efficient methods for estrus detection and timely insemination. Controlled breeding experiments in the buffalo had been limited and similar to those applied in cattle. Studies on multiple ovulation and embryo transfer are essentially a replica of those in cattle, however with inherent problems such as lower number of primordial follicles on the buffalo ovary, poor fertility and seasonality of reproduction, lower population of antral follicles at all stages of the estrous cycle, poor endocrine status and a high incidence of deep atresia in ovarian follicles, the response in terms of transferable embryo recovery has remained low with 0.51 to 3.0 per donor and pregnancy rates between 15 to 30%. The Garole is a prolific breed of microsheep that possesses the FecB gene, which increases ovulation rate. The purpose of this study was to compare embryo production by multiple ovulation in seven Garole ewes with that in seven normal size, non-prolific Malpura ewes, and assess the influence of the large body size of Awassi crossbred recipient ewes on the birth-weight of Garole lambs. Oestrus was synchronised with two intramuscular injections of 7.5 mg prostaglandin F(2alpha) administered 10 days apart. The donor ewes were superovulated by the use of pregnant mare serum gonadotrophin and follicle-stimulating hormone. The onset and duration of oestrus were similar in both breeds. The Garole donors had higher total mean (se) ovarian responses (15.6 [3.6] v 9.1 [2.3]), ovulation rate (13.6 [3.1] v 8.4 [2.2]) and produced more transferable embryos (6.0 [3.5] v 4.0 [0.9]) than the Malpura donors, but the differences were not statistically significant. Donor Mare - Embryo transfer begins with breeding the donor mare to semen from the chosen stud. Bred as usual, the donor is monitored daily using ultrasound to establish the exact date of ovulation.. Recipient Mare - Recipient mares (the ones receiving the embryo) are also monitored with ultrasound, and synchronized to prepare them to receive the donated embryo around day 7 of pregnancy.. The Flush - Seven days after the ovulation date, the donor mares uterus is flushed. This timing maximizes the chance of recovering an embryo at the ideal age. The fluid from the uterus is run through a special filter designed to catch the embryo.. Embryo Recovery - The flushed embryo is identified under a microscope. A transferable embryo is between 6 and 8 days old. At 5 days, the embryo is not yet in the mares uterus and cannot be flushed. At 9 days, the embryo becomes too large and fragile to handle. All ovulation induction drugs work by either increasing the patients own FSH (oral meds including Clomid or Letrozole) or by providing exogenous (already made from an outside source) FSH (injectables like Gonal F, Puregon, Menopure/HMG). It is the injectable drugs that achieve superovulation. Injectables can also be used for a small percent of patients who are resistant to oral medications in order to achieve single ovulation (monofollicular development).. Careful monitoring and dose adjustment are mandatory for safe ovulation induction, especially when injectables are used. Proper timing of the ovulation trigger is mandatory for proper egg maturation, to deliver the sperm at the ideal time, or to time when to collect the eggs in cases of IVF treatment.. Proper monitoring and frequent dose adjustment with proper, timely communication are mandatory for safe and successful treatment.. We induced superovulation in 6- to 8-week-old (C57BL/6J × DBA/2J)F1 (B6D2F1) mice by i.p. injection of 7.5 U pregnant mare serum gonadotropin (PMSG) and, 48 hours later, 7.5 U human choriogonadotropin (hCG). We harvested oviducts and collected cumulus oocyte complexes (COCs) 16 hours after hCG injection. Cumulus cells were removed with hyaluronidase (1 mg/ml for 10 minutes at room temperature). We subsequently activated oocytes with strontium chloride (10 mmol/l in Ca2+-free CZB medium in mmol/l: NaCl 82.7, KCl 4.68, KH2PO4 1.17, MgSO4 1.18, D-glucose 5.6, Na-lactate 30.1, EDTA2Na 0.1, NaHCO3 25, Na-pyruvate 0.62, glutamine 1; supplemented with 5 mg/ml BSA, and 100 U/ml penicillin and 100 μg/ml streptomycin [100 P/S]) for 6 hours and prevented second polar body extrusion with cytochalasin B (5 μg/ml). Research on in vitro embryo production (IVP) in the equine is impeded by the limited availability of mature oocytes as the mare is mono ovulating and superovulation is still difficult (Dippert and Squires, 1994; Bezard et al., 1995; Alvarenga et al., 2001b). Despite recent improvement in IVM of equine oocytes, success rates of IVM in that species remain low in all culture media tested compared to other species (Goudet et al., 2000b). However, most studies have focused on the percentage of oocytes reaching the metaphase II stage (nuclear maturation) but few concentrated on the final oocyte competence as measured by its ability to develop into a blastocyst and further establish a pregnancy. Blastocyst production rate is influenced not only by culture environment but also by oocyte maturation conditions. Under in vitro culture conditions, oxidative modifications of cell components via increased ROS represent a major culture induced stress (Johnson and Nasr-Esfahani, 1994). A case-control study was conducted in 2013 to investigate the use of pituitary-derived hormones from sheep as a potential risk factor for the presence of atypical scrapie in Great Britain sheep holdings. One hundred and sixty-five holdings were identified as cases. Two equal sets of controls were selected: no case of scrapie and cases of classical scrapie. A total of 495 holdings were selected for the questionnaire survey, 201 responses were received and 190 (38.3 per cent) were suitable for analysis. The variables use-of-heat-synchronisation/superovulation and flock size were significantly associated with the occurrence of atypical scrapie. Farms with atypical cases were less likely (OR 0.25, 95 per cent CI 0.07 to 0.89) to implement heat synchronisation/superovulation in the flock than the control group. Atypical cases were 3.3 times (95 per cent CI 1.38 to 8.13) more likely to occur in large holdings (,879 sheep) than in small flocks (,164 sheep). If the ...
